Nigeria Coach has not received any payment from Federation over the last 8 months

Super Eagles Head Coach Gernot Rohr has now not been paid for eight months as the team is getting ready to face Central African Republic in two2022 World Cup qualifiers this week.

Rohr is on a reduced monthly salary of $45,000 and it is from there that he pays the team’s video analyst, chief scout as well as fitness and goalkeeper trainers.

Official representants from the federation have continued to promise that the salaries will be cleared soon.

 

The Nigeria Football Federation (NFF) had previously announced that national team coaches will no longer be owed salaries directly from the federation because the sponsors money is supposed to take care of this.

Rohr’s contract runs till June 2022. He has been demanded to win the 2021 AFCON to be played in Cameroon in January before receiving any extension offer.
